You have been told that, even like a chain, you are as weak as your weakest link.

This is but half the truth.

You are also as strong as your strongest link.

To measure you by your smallest deed is to reckon the power of the ocean by the frailty of its foam.

To judge you by your failures is to cast blame upon the seasons for their inconstancy

A Warrior knows that an angel and a devil are both competing for his sword hand.

The devil says: "You will weaken. You will not know exactly when. You are afraid."

 The angel says: "You will weaken. You will not know exactly when. You are afraid."

The Warrior is surprised. Both the angel and the devil have said the same thing.

The devil continues: "Let me help you." 

And the angel says: "I will help you."

At that moment the Warrior understands the difference.

The words may be the same but these two allies are completely different.


And he chooses the angel's hand.

This is why alchemy exists

 So that everyone will search for his treasure, find it, and then want to be better than he was in his former life.

 Lead will play its role until the world has no further need for lead; 

and then lead will have to turn itself into gold.


That's what alchemists do. 

They show that, when we strive to become better than we are, everything around us becomes better, too.
